NORTH DEVON FERRY A STEP CLOSER

April 17, 2009 10:50 AM

Puddleduck amphibious vehicle'I have always been very supportive of the idea of a North Devon Ferry Devon running along the Taw. This initiative was first raised in 2007 and I am very pleased to have been informed that Devon Duck Tours are now a step closer to fruition.

'The plan is to make the service a reality later this year. The intention remains to operate scheduled services using a custom built amphibious DUKW between Appledore, Instow and Crow Point.

'This is to be started using a vehicle from the former Puddleduck fleet on Jersey which used to run ferry service to Elizabeth castle for tourists. The vehicle awaits shipment, but it is hoped to have it ready by July.

'This project can only help stimulate tourism in North Devon particularly along the Taw and the adjacent Tarka trail and I wish it every success in the coming months.'
